The MSM7652 is a digital NTSC/PAL encoder. By inputting digital image data conforming to ITU Rec. 656 or ITURBT 601, it outputs selected analog composite video signals, analog S video signals or Y, R-Y, B-Y signals. For the scanning system, interlaced or noninterlaced mode can be selected.
Since the MSM7652 is provided with pins dedicated to overlay function, text and graphics can be superimposed on a video signal.
In addition, this encoder has an internal 10-bit DAC. So, when compared with using a conventional analog encoder, the number of components, the board space, and points of adjustment can greatly be reduced, thereby realizing a low cost and high-accuracy system.
The MSM7652 provides the optional functions such as Closed Caption Signal Generation Function.
The host interface provided conforms to Philips's I2C specifications, which reduces interconnections between this encoder and mounting components.
The internal synchronization signal generator (SSG) allows the MSM7652 to operate in master mode.
